In the past several months, the United States has been subject to a stream of nationwide clown sightings. These sightings are often met with resistance as these figures are hoping to lure women and children into woods. While there have not been any fatalities from these attacks to date, this is still an issue that awareness must be raised against. There have been several encounters that started in the east and have now swept the nation with the most recent being in Texas. Our nation doesn't know precisely what to think about this epidemic especially so close to Halloween. Individuals are being urged to not dress up as clowns for this holiday in order to contain the public's anxiety about this issue. Some communities have put up notices encouraging individuals to not travel alone at night and some have even recommended a curfew to keep people of the street in the later hours of the night for protection. Overall, America is being faced with something we do not completely understand ourselves due to the fact that there has not been enough face-to-face acts of violence to group these antics as a whole. However, we must attempt to protect ourselves before this situation gets out of hand.
